About This Job: Electrical Power-Line Installers and Repairers

Install or repair cables or wires used in electrical power or distribution systems. May erect poles and light or heavy duty transmission towers.

Salary Range: Electrical Power-Line Installers and Repairers in Iowa

Salaries for Electrical Power-Line Installers and Repairers in Iowa range from $56,760 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$107,510 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$77,350 and $101,930.

Percentile Annual Salary Hourly Rate Monthly
10th Percentile (Entry Level) $56,760 $27.29 $4,730
25th Percentile $77,350 $37.19 $6,445
Median (50th) $95,850 $46.08 $7,987
75th Percentile $101,930 $49.00 $8,494
90th Percentile (Experienced) $107,510 $51.69 $8,959

Note: The mean (average) salary of $88,500 differs from the median because salary distributions are typically skewed by high earners.

Data Source & Methodology

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2024 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.

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
